ORDER

(made by N.Sathish Kumar, J.) This writ petition has been filed seeking direction to the fourth respondent/Central Administrative Tribunal, Chennai Bench, to dispose the Contempt Application No.25 of 2022 within a reasonable time limit as may be prescribed by this Court.

2.

It is the case of the petitioners that though the order was passed in their favour on 20.12.2021 in O.A.No.965 of 2019, the same has not been implemented so far. Therefore, they have filed a Contempt Application No.25 of 2022. However, the same has been repeatedly adjourned without disposal. Hence, they have preferred the present petition.

3.

The learned Special Government Pleader (Puducherry) appearing for the respondents 1 to 3 would submit that the matter is posted on 01.12.2025 for appearance of the respondents. 4.

In such view of the matter, this Court is of the opinion that no time limit can be fixed. However, since the contempt application was filed in the year 2022, the Tribunal shall dispose of the same as expeditiously as possible.

With the above direction, this writ petition stands disposed of. No costs. Connected W.M.P. is closed.
